Safety
Bunk beds can be an ideal solution to reduce space in bedrooms or communal living spaces. They can be hazardous for children as well as adults. They can be especially risky for children because of the height of the top bunk and the absence of guardrails. This could cause injuries or falls. There are numerous safety features that can help prevent these problems. Before deciding on a bunk bed, it's important to take into consideration the capacity of each mattress as well as the overall frame.
Ideally, bunk beds should be constructed from strong materials that can support the weight of sleepers of all sizes. You can also find bunk beds constructed with sustainably sourced materials and GreenGuard Gold certifications, which signifies low emissions from chemicals.
While there are plenty of cheap bunk bed options, it's important to prioritize safety when shopping for this type of furniture. Choose an extremely sturdy bunk bed that can accommodate a full-size mattress or two twin mattresses, and select a model that has a fixed ladder that can be placed on either side of the bed. Some models come with stairs that are easier to climb, and also take up less space. However, they can be dangerous for older children.
It is also essential to determine the weight capacity of the bunk bed and if it is able to withstand a blow to the structure. For example, a child may accidentally jump off the top bunk. It is also beneficial to teach your children to avoid rough play on the bunk beds as it can cause accidents and falls.
Lastly, it's important to check that the bunk bed you're considering will fit through your doorways and hallways. It shouldn't be difficult for children to move into and out of. Also, you should look at the dimensions of your ceiling to determine if there's enough space for the bunk bed and its trundle or storage drawers.
Style
Bunk beds can be a great way to save space in a bedroom, and they create a sense of community between siblings or roommates. However, they can present some challenges. The pinnacle bunk is hard to access, even with guardrails. This could make it difficult for children or people who have mobility problems. The shared area for snoozing can also restrict personal space, which can cause privacy issues.
Some bunk beds come with features that solve these issues. Some bunk beds feature stairs that have storage built-in to keep the room neat and accessible for children who are afraid of climbing ladders. Some have trundles that can be used as extra beds, eliminating the need for an additional guest mattress. Bunk beds can be found in a variety of styles including traditional sleigh designs and posters to contemporary metal frame and wood paneled versions.
When looking for bunk beds, it is important to be aware of the height of your ceiling. Generally, you'll want to choose a bed that is not higher than 67.6 inches, since this will ensure that your kids will have enough room to rest comfortably. Some bunk bed designers have developed designs that are suitable for low ceilings, which allow you to get a bunk bed that will work in nearly any home.

Materials
Bunk beds are classic for many reasons, and they're ideal for families with two or more children. They're a great option to make space and give your children a place to sleep. They also provide space for cousins or siblings to visit. The majority of bunks have attached or built-in ladders to ensure safety and easy access to the top bed, and some even have storage spaces underneath the bottom bunk for bedding and toys. The bunks are typically constructed out of strong, sturdy materials like metal or wood and can be a great long-term investment for your family.
Pick a bunk bed made of top-quality wood. This kind of wood is able to withstand years of use and is more durable than particle board, MDF or engineered wood. Bunks made from oak or solid pine are especially sturdy and can stand up to even the most arduous tinkering or playtime.
You could consider a bunk bed with a trundle to provide additional sleeping space. They are great for the kids' cabin in the mountains or the lake house or for a smaller-sized apartment that will allow for another guest to sleep comfortably. This kind of bunk bed typically includes a twin-over-twin mission style bunk bed with slatted headboard and foot boards with safety guardrails that wrap around, an integrated ladder and a trundle that's capable of supporting a mattress that is large enough.
Many customers favor shorter bunk beds as they're an easier option for smaller rooms. These bunks are perfect for kids who aren't yet ready to move on to the traditional queen-sized or full-sized bunk bed.
